Electric Box Mural Project

The electric box mural project is a public art initiative that transforms electrical control boxes into small-scale works of art. The team at DiRT & Glitter have designed seven murals which will be painted onto to these otherwise utilitarian structures, turning them into visually engaging features within the streetscape. This project is open to participants in the DiRT & Glitter summer program, ages 16+.


The purpose of this project is to enhance neighborhood aesthetics, deter graffiti and vandalism, and create a stronger sense of place. The designs will reflect local history, culture, natural landscapes, or community identity, making each box a unique expression of the area. Because of their visibility and relatively low cost, electric box mural projects are an effective and scalable way for cities to integrate public art into everyday infrastructure while supporting local artists and community pride. All necessary contracts are in place and the locations for the first round of murals have been selected. The designs will go before the Planning Commission for approval on May 14, 2026.
